Considerations To Know About what is md5 technology
Considerations To Know About what is md5 technology
Blog Article
Even though the cybersecurity landscape is consistently birthing improved and more robust means of ensuring details stability, MD5 stays, as both a tale of progress and one among caution.
Collision vulnerability. MD5 is at risk of collision assaults, exactly where two diverse inputs deliver the same hash worth. This flaw compromises the integrity on the hash functionality, allowing for attackers to substitute destructive details without the need of detection.
Info is often confirmed for integrity utilizing MD5 being a checksum functionality to make certain that it hasn't come to be accidentally corrupted. Information can make glitches when they're unintentionally changed in a few of the next strategies:
Specified these types of occurrences, cybercriminals could presumably switch a real file by using a malicious file that generates the identical hash. To fight this threat, more recent variations on the algorithm have already been created, namely SHA-two and SHA-three, and therefore are suggested for more secure tactics.
Normal Depreciation: MD5 is deprecated For numerous stability-crucial apps on account of numerous flaws and weaknesses. Based on the common businesses and protection gurus, MD5 is disengaged for cryptographic applications.
This superior sensitivity to changes makes it excellent for data integrity checks. If even a single pixel of an image is altered, the MD5 hash will change, alerting you to the modification.
This is why, sometimes, It is far better to maneuver on to additional fashionable and secure alternate options. But hey, we are going to take a look at Those people in the following part.
At the end of these 4 rounds, the output from Just about every block is merged to generate the final MD5 hash. This hash would be the 128-bit price we discussed earlier.
MD5 can also be however Employed in cybersecurity to confirm and authenticate electronic signatures. Making use of MD5, a user can confirm that a downloaded file is authentic by matching the private and non-private crucial and hash values. Due to the substantial level of MD5 collisions, nonetheless, this information-digest algorithm is not ideal for verifying the integrity of knowledge or files as risk actors can certainly replace the hash value with among their own individual.
To avoid wasting time, we will make use of a hexadecimal to decimal converter to do the operate for us. After we enter in our check here hexadecimal hash, we learn that:
MD5 digests are actually extensively Utilized in the program planet to offer some assurance that a transferred file has arrived intact. For example, file servers usually offer a pre-computed MD5 (often called md5sum) checksum for the information, making sure that a person can Look at the checksum in the downloaded file to it.
Irrespective of breaches like Individuals explained over, MD5 can however be utilized for normal file verifications and as being a checksum to confirm data integrity, but only in opposition to unintentional corruption.
SHA-one can however be used to verify previous time stamps and electronic signatures, although the NIST (Countrywide Institute of Requirements and Technology) will not advocate applying SHA-one to generate digital signatures or in circumstances the place collision resistance is necessary.
In 1996, collisions were being found in the compression function of MD5, and Hans Dobbertin wrote inside the RSA Laboratories complex publication, "The offered assault would not yet threaten practical applications of MD5, nevertheless it arrives relatively near .